Organizing a Kitchen
For many families, the kitchen is the place where
the most hours of the day are spent. Here are a few tips to keep
your kitchen properly organized to help things run smoothly.
- Store glasses such as stemware by placing every other glass upside
down. Be sure to line the shelves so that the rims of the glasses are
not touching the bottom of the cabinet.
- Group like items together.
- Place bookshelves or bookcases in the kitchen as a place to store
glassware, cookbooks, canisters, hand mixers or even food. This will
also provide handy places to set small appliances.
- A pegboard can easily hold gadgets, pots and pans. Decorate the pegboard
to match your kitchen’s decor.
- Arrange a communication center by placing a bulletin board near the
telephone, and put up some shelves to hold cookbooks, telephone books,
pens, paper and other supplies.
- Store items nearby for easy reach. Keep spatulas close to the stove.
- Store every day dishes and silverware near the dishwasher or sink.
